We asked the dealer this question when we ordered our car and were told no.

Our first 330d had Michelin Pilot Sports (non run flat) on it when we got it and we put Pilot Sport 2s on when they needed changing. Our last 330d had Bridgestones and we weren't too happy with them, the grip wasn't there and they used to tramline a lot.

Our current 335d is on Pilot Sport 2s (run flats) and another of my cars is on 18" PS2s as well.
